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
997637883 497620017 709
754693 028
754693 028
2187165 73215 4805902
All about undefined
Interested in learning more?
754693 028
2187165 73215 4805902
See more
66493283 79891416 037579
5247866381 14600603 541 43308637534 15
See more
11851 20332079887
041365944 66437 7657202
See more